OSHKOSH, Wis–The city of Oshkosh will continue to have a mayor. The Common Council rejects an ordinance change that would have re-titled the position “Council President”. Current Mayor Matt Mugerauer proposed the change, saying the City Manager-Council form of government gives the position little extra power.
Council member Karl Buhlow says a new name won’t change that confusion………….
The proposed ordinance would have still allowed for direct election of the Council President, like is done for the mayor’s position.
